Naples, Inc. recorded operating data for its shoe division for theyear.

Sales$750,000

Contribution margin135,000

Total fixed costs90,000

Average total operating assets300,000

How much is ROI for the year if management is able to identify a way to improve the contribution margin by $30,000, assuming fixed costs are held constant?
